Compensatory Plasticity
The brain's ability to reorganize and adjust its activities in response to injury or disease, or as a result of learning or experience.
Neural Change
Alterations in the structure or function of the nervous system as a result of growth, learning, or experience.
Behavioral Symptoms
Observable actions or behaviors exhibited by an individual that may indicate the presence of a neurological or psychiatric condition.
Neuronal Plasticity
The capacity of neurons and neural networks in the brain to change their connections and behavior in response to new information, sensory stimulation, development, damage, or dysfunction.
